Hydrangea p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of hydrangea bushes to promote healthy growth and enhance their appearance. Skilled service providers evaluate the specific type of hydrangea, as different varieties require distinct pruning techniques. The process typically includes removing dead or damaged stems, thinning out overcrowded branches, and selectively cutting back old growth to encourage new flowering stems. Proper pruning can improve the plant’s overall structure, increase flower production, and maintain a tidy, attractive landscape feature.
Pruning hydrangeas addresses common problems such as leggy growth, disease susceptibility, and reduced flowering. Overgrown or improperly maintained bushes may become unruly, making them difficult to manage and detracting from the property's visual appeal. Additionally, removing dead or diseased wood helps prevent the spread of pests and infections. Regular pruning also ensures that the plant’s energy is directed toward healthy growth and abundant blooms, ultimately extending the lifespan and vitality of the hydrangea.

The overview below groups typical Hydrangea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Butte County,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Pruning - The typical cost for basic hydrangea pruning ranges from $50 to $150 per service. This usually includes removing dead or overgrown branches to promote healthy growth.
Seasonal Trimming - Seasonal trimming services generally cost between $75 and $200, depending on the size and number of plants. This service helps maintain the desired shape and size of hydrangeas.
Deep Shaping and Reshaping - More extensive shaping can range from $150 to $400 per session. This includes significant cuts to improve structure and aesthetics, often for larger or older plants.
Commercial or Large-Scale Pruning - Large or commercial hydrangea pruning projects typically cost $300 to $800 or more, based on the scope and number of plants involved. Local pros provide estimates tailored to specific property need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When is the best time to prune hydrangeas? The ideal time to prune hydrangeas depends on the variety, but generally, late winter or early spring is suitable for most types. Local landscaping professionals can provide guidance based on specific hydrangea varieties and local climate conditions.
How much should I prune my hydrangea? The amount of pruning varies by hydrangea type and desired appearance. Consulting local pros can help determine the appropriate pruning level to promote healthy growth and flowering.
Can I prune hydrangeas in the fall? Fall pruning is usually not recommended for most hydrangea varieties, as it can remove buds for the next season's blooms. Local experts can advise on the best timing for pruning based on the specific plant.
